How is the weather in Mafra?
Mafra tends to have a mild climate, with warm, dry summers and cooler, wetter winters. Light layers are useful for changing conditions, especially if exploring outdoor sites.

What is Mafra known for?
Mafra is known for its grand National Palace, which includes a historic basilica and a Baroque-era library. The area is also recognized for natural parklands, artisan bakeries, and traditional religious processions.
